Jason O’Rourke
10 Feb 2021 · Inner South London
Concerns: HMP Belmarsh's immediate needs form inadequately assesses self-harm risk for new prisoners without existing care plans. The nightly roll check system lacks robust auditing, risking missed checks and compromising prisoner safety.
Response (HM Prison and Probation Service): HMP Belmarsh has updated its 'immediate needs' form for new prisoners to provide clearer guidance to staff on actions to take regarding suicide/self-harm risks, including communication with healthcare and documentation. …
Responded
Giuseppe Tabone and Andrew Evans
12 Mar 2024 · East Sussex
Concerns: Prison staff failed to perform mandatory roll checks, with falsified records and confusion over requirements, creating a risk of undetected prisoner medical emergencies.
Response (HM Prison and Probation Service): HMP Lewes investigated and disciplined staff who failed to carry out roll checks, and has planned further 'bite size' training sessions on roll checks with support from the standards coaching …
Responded
Brandon Johnson
01 Oct 2024 · Inner West London
Concerns: Inadequate and unreliable procedures for checking prisoners' signs of life, with staff lacking sufficient time and clear training to perform robust, positive-response checks in cells.
Response (HM Prison and Probation Service): HMP Wandsworth issued a notice in March 2021 to remind staff to have clear sight of prisoners and obtain signs of life during roll checks and have published further communications …

The Governor
The Governor should ensure that all staff understand the importance of conducting roll checks and welfare checks at the prescribed times and record the time the roll check was completed in the daily diary, in line with the Local Security …
The Governor
The Governor should ensure that staff understand the importance of conducting roll checks as required.
The Director at Parc
The Director at Parc should ensure that Parc’s instructions to staff about roll checks are consistent.
The Governor
The Governor should ensure that all staff understand of the importance of conducting roll checks at the prescribed times and record the time the roll check is completed in the daily diary, in line with the Local Security Strategy.
The Governor
The Governor should ensure that staff completing roll checks satisfy themselves that prisoners are alive and well.
The Director at Parc
The Director at Parc should ensure that when a cell door is unlocked, staff satisfy themselves of the wellbeing of the prisoner and that there are no immediate issues that need attention.
The Director of HMP Lowdham Grange
The Director should outline to the Ombudsman their plan going forward to randomly sample the accuracy of recorded checks until they are satisfied there is not a systemic issue with false entries.
The Governor
The Governor should ensure that when staff have concerns about a prisoner’s wellbeing during a roll check, they obtain a response from them to check they are alive and well.
The Governor
The Governor should ensure that staff carry out roll checks at the required times and only sign for them if they have completed them themselves.
The Director at HMP Lowdham Grange
The Director at HMP Lowdham Grange should ensure that staff understand they should complete a welfare check at unlock and consider randomised checks of CCTV footage to ensure they are being done.
The Governor of HMP Birmingham
The Governor should introduce a robust quality assurance process to ensure that staff conduct routine roll checks and welfare checks in line with local and national guidelines.
The Governor
The Governor should review the guidance on roll checks and covered observation panels.
